Description
Barium Disalicylate is an organometallic compound of barium and salicylic acid. This specialty chemical is valued for its role as a stabilizer and catalyst precursor in various high-performance polymer and resin systems. It is primarily utilized by manufacturers in the plastics, coatings, and specialty chemical synthesis industries seeking to enhance product thermal stability and processing characteristics.
Application
- Polymer Stabilizer: Acts as a heat stabilizer and co-stabilizer in PVC and other halogenated polymer formulations to prevent degradation during processing and extend service life.
- Catalyst Precursor: Serves as a starting material or catalyst component in organic synthesis and polymerization reactions.
- Cross-linking Agent: Used in the production of specialty resins and elastomers where it contributes to the formation of thermally stable networks.
- Additive for Coatings: Incorporated into industrial coating systems to improve durability, adhesion, and resistance to environmental factors.
- Laboratory Reagent: Employed in research and development for synthesizing novel coordination compounds and studying metal-organic frameworks (MOFs).
Basic Information
| Product Name | Barium Disalicylate |
| CAS No. | 5908-78-1 |
| Molecular Formula | C14H10BaO6 |
| Molecular Weight | 411.63 g/mol |
| Synonyms | Barium Salicylate; Barium Bis(salicylate); Dibarium Disalicylate; Salicylic Acid, Barium Salt; Barium Salicylate Basic; Barium Di(salicylate); 2-Hydroxybenzoic Acid Barium Salt; Barium Salicylate (1:2) |
| EINECS | 227-614-1 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ive) and must be kept in a dry environment to prevent caking and degradation.
